The main residence has been sympathetically converted. Retaining many original features including exposed stonework and beams with all the conveniences of modern family living. A welcoming entrance leads to the ground floor accommodation with a characterful sitting room featuring a wood-burning stove. The spacious kitchen/breakfast room is fitted with classic cabinetry and a central island. There is a separate dining room ideal for entertaining and a study/home office. A bedroom, additional reception/family areas, plus a utility room complete the ground floor. To the first floor, the accommodation continues with five well-proportioned bedrooms for a growing family. The principal bedroom features a vaulted ceiling and further bedrooms offer flexibility for family living served by a family bathroom and additional shower facilities. The annexe is an independant living space offering a range of lifestyle options such as guests, relatives, home working or generating an income. The accommodation includes living space, bedroom accommodation, kitchen and bathroom facility.

Outside

The property is approached via a generous driveway providing parking for several vehicles, leading to a detached garage and to the front entrance. To the rear, there is a a beautifully enclosed high stone walling creating privacy and designed for ease of maintenance. The outdoor living features a paved terrace, lawned areas framed by well stocked flowering borders and a Pergola for sheltered spaces. A garden office is ideal for home working. There is a workshop space, perfect for hobbies or business use.

Situation

Farthinghoe is situated between Banbury and Brackley. It has a thriving community and the Fox Public House. It benefits from its own Community Primary School, other local primary schools are located at Middleton Cheney and also Chenderit Secondary School. There is also a train station in Banbury providing access to London Marylebone and access to the M40 (jct 11).
